Hidden Gems and Local Favorites
For adventure seekers, Rishikesh offers some off-the-beaten-path attractions. Try cliff jumping at the lesser-known Phool Chatti, situated upstream from Rishikesh. Another hidden gem is the Neelkanth Mahadev Temple, located amidst lush forests, where you can hike and witness breathtaking panoramic views. Locals also love exploring the nearby village of Byasi, known for its natural beauty and outdoor activities like camping and rock climbing.
